This was my first Brittanee Nicole book, but it was easy to jump into the Bristol Bay world and become familiar with all of the characters that lived within it.

Shawn Chase, while he'd been a famous baseball pitcher, was currently living in his sister’s basement and tending bar at his best friend's bar and restaurant while he was figuring out his next steps in life. This was when his friend sent him his wish reminder about mixing up his life and wouldn't you know it had more to do about his coming days than his bleak past when he'd filled out that dollar bill wish. As we quickly learn, Shawn is a man who makes bold moves and is probably the sweetest man to walk around the Bristol Bay area. While he originally thought he was making a move on his best friend, Hailey, it turns out it was actually her estranged twin sister, Jules. She's just arrived in town and looking to reunite with her family when Shawn walks up to her and kisses her and let me tell you, the sparks ignite leading them on a path to all kinds of new found discovery, but before either of them can really figure out what that means, there are a lot of obstacles that end up on their path to love. 

I loved the steam and romance that brewed between Shawn and Jules throughout the entire book. It was one that brewed slowly, even after that initial kiss, but let's face it, they were literal strangers and took their time to get to know one another, but once they did...full steam ahead.

Also, with the small town atmosphere, the camaraderie between all of the cast, especially Shawn's friends was a total joy to read. Jules' family was a bit slower to warm to, just given the circumstances, but Shawn is the ever present cinnamon roll to help ease the tension and I loved him all the more for his charismatic sweetness.

A 4.5 star rating overall.

Whilst I haven’t read any of the previous books in this series, I never felt as if I was struggling to keep up and/or make heads-or-tails of the large cast of characters belonging to Bristol Bay—aka this did well as a standalone. I do wish that the arsonist plot, which was more or less in the backseat throughout the story, had been wrapped up in this book. But alas, I guess I’ll have to wait for answers.
